#0f3342 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0f3342 is composed of 5.9% red, 20% green and 25.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 77.3% cyan, 22.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 74.1% black. It has a hue angle of 197.6 degrees, a saturation of 63% and a lightness of 15.9%. #0f3342 color hex could be obtained by blending #1e6684 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003333.

Shades and Tints of #0f3342

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000202 is the darkest color, while #f1f9f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#0f3342

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#282929 is the less saturated color, while #03384e is the most saturated one.
